溫馨提示×

php如何轉(zhuǎn)換字符串

PHP
小億
82
2024-09-05 08:08:49
欄目: 編程語言

在PHP中,可以使用內(nèi)置的字符串函數(shù)來轉(zhuǎn)換字符串。這里有一些常見的字符串轉(zhuǎn)換方法:

  1. 大小寫轉(zhuǎn)換:
    • strtolower():將字符串轉(zhuǎn)換為小寫
    • strtoupper():將字符串轉(zhuǎn)換為大寫
    • ucfirst():將字符串的第一個字母轉(zhuǎn)換為大寫
    • ucwords():將字符串中每個單詞的首字母轉(zhuǎn)換為大寫

示例:

$str = "Hello World!";
echo strtolower($str); // 輸出: hello world!
echo strtoupper($str); // 輸出: HELLO WORLD!
echo ucfirst($str); // 輸出: Hello World!
echo ucwords($str); // 輸出: Hello World!
  1. 字符串替換:
    • str_replace():替換字符串中的一部分

示例:

$str = "Hello World!";
echo str_replace("World", "PHP", $str); // 輸出: Hello PHP!
  1. 字符串編碼轉(zhuǎn)換:
    • mb_convert_encoding():轉(zhuǎn)換字符串的編碼

示例:

$str = "你好,世界!";
echo mb_convert_encoding($str, "UTF-8", "GBK"); // 將GBK編碼的字符串轉(zhuǎn)換為UTF-8編碼
  1. 其他字符串處理函數(shù):
    • trim():去除字符串兩側(cè)的空白字符
    • ltrim():去除字符串左側(cè)的空白字符
    • rtrim():去除字符串右側(cè)的空白字符
    • substr():從字符串中提取一部分
    • strlen():獲取字符串長度
    • str_repeat():重復(fù)字符串
    • str_pad():填充字符串

這只是PHP字符串操作的一部分。更多字符串函數(shù)和詳細(xì)信息,請參閱PHP官方文檔:https://www.php.net/manual/zh/ref.strings.php

0